
Senior Hardware Prototyping Technician

This is a fully remote position, open to applicants in Kansas.
• Assemble, solder, rework, and integrate electronic prototypes, printed circuit assemblies (PCAs), and cabling.
• Conduct hardware bring-up, functional testing, and troubleshooting for both prototype and production units.
• Construct and maintain test fixtures, jigs, and benches for validation and production purposes.
• Operate lab equipment, including oscilloscopes, multimeters, power supplies, and soldering/rework stations.
• Assist in field-test preparation, kitting, and logistics for hardware deployments.
• Ensure accurate build records, as-built documentation, and component inventory are maintained.
• Provide mentorship to junior technicians and uphold ESD, safety, and quality protocols.
• Collaborate with engineering teams to enhance manufacturability and assembly processes.
• Must be eligible to obtain a U.S. Security Clearance – U.S. Citizenship is required.
• Associate degree or technical certification in electronics, or equivalent experience is necessary.
• A minimum of 7 years of hands-on experience in electronics assembly, rework, and testing is required.
• Advanced skills in soldering and rework, including fine-pitch and surface-mount work (IPC-A-610 / J-STD-001 certification is a plus).
• Proficient in using lab and test equipment and capable of reading schematics, BOMs, and assembly drawings.
• Experience in building and bringing up prototype hardware in a fast-paced environment is essential.
• Strong attention to detail and a disciplined approach to documentation are critical.
• Flexibility to work long hours as necessary.
